Division · motion

UK Government Welfare Reforms

S6M-17242 · decided 23 Apr 2025 · lodged by Somerville, Shirley-Anne · session S6
Watch the debate on SPTV
Carried 73/40
That the Parliament calls on the UK Labour administration to immediately scrap its damaging social security reforms, as announced in the Pathways to Work: Reforming Benefits and Support to Get Britain Working Green Paper; highlights the UK Government’s own impact analysis, which shows that 250,000 people, including 50,000 children, will be pushed into poverty under these plans, and notes the Resolution Foundation’s report that lower-income households are set to become £500 a year poorer, following the UK Government’s Spring Statement 2025.
